Raleigh Water - Water Distribution division is looking for a Utilities Specialist - Investigations to join our team. Utilities Specialists are devoted to completing preventive maintenance, utility repairs, utility locating, participating in investigations within our water system and providing excellent customer service. The Utilities Technician also performs skilled maintenance and equipment operations for the City's distribution system in support of maintaining, replacing, and repairing water assets, such as services, mains, fire hydrants, and so forth. About Us : Raleigh Water, the Public Utilities Department of the City of Raleigh, serves over 200,000 metered customers and a community of around 630,000 residents across Raleigh, Garner, Wake Forest, Rolesville, Knightdale, Wendell, and Zebulon. Our mission is to ensure access to safe, sustainable water while safeguarding public health and enhancing the overall vitality of our communities. We strive to lead with innovation and integrity, fostering a resilient future for the regions we serve. Work Hours : Scheduled working hours are Monday through Friday from 6 : 30 am to 3 : 00 pm. This position includes rotating after-hours on-call responsibilities, including serving as a secondary lead on an on-call emergency crew. When on call, you'll receive standby pay for 8 hours at your regular hourly rate. If you're called out to work during your on-call shift, you'll be compensated at the overtime rate as per our company policy. We understand that flexibility is key! Our on-call schedules can vary based on seasonal needs and operational requirements. Therefore, the ability to work a flexible schedule is essential for this role.

Identifies issues in the water distribution system pertaining to system Investigates and locates missing data from maps, provides maps to update GIS, turns valves for shutdowns for projects and contractors. Researches pipe type and size, communicates with citizens and collects water samples, locates water lines and assets located in the water system, and investigates system anomalies Uses different types of survey equipment such as GPR cart, Trimble and Metrotech 810 to complete work Serves as a team lead on various projects

Typical Qualifications : Education and Experience : High School diploma or G.E.D. equivalency and 3 to 5 years' experience in water / wastewater infrastructure inspection, maintenance / repair or related work, such as : Landscaping : installer, maintenance, irrigation Construction : grading, storm drain, site work, builder, plumber, any utility construction (including fiber installation), road construction Mechanic : heavy equipment, HVAC, hydraulic systems Farming : manual labor, equipment operating Moving Company : labor, truck driver General Municipal Worker : utility inspector Tech School Student : mechanical Firefighter : full or part-time OR Any equivalent combination of training and / or experience that provides the required knowledge, skills and abilities may be substituted Licensing and Certifications : Valid North Carolina Class C Driver's License with a satisfactory driving record, or the ability to obtain within 60 days of hire Valid North Carolina Class A Commercial Driver's License with a satisfactory driving record, or the ability to obtain within 90 days of hire

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ities : Operating and driving heavy equipment such as a dump truck, tractor-trailer, tractor, flatbed truck or water truck Hauling materials, supplies, equipment, and soil Inspecting assigned equipment for mechanical readiness Performing minor preventative maintenance on equipment Proofreading and error correction Monitoring and maintaining required supplies, materials, and inventory Performing basic math calculations Comprehending reference books and manuals Operating assigned tools and equipment Organizing and maintaining records and files Interpreting and applying applicable laws, codes, regulations, and standards Providing customer service
